65-1,187. Odor control plan. (a) As a condition of issuance of a permit for a swine facility, the department shall require the applicant to submit a plan, approved by the department, for odor control if the application is for:

(1) A permit for construction or expansion of a swine facility that has an animal unit capacity of 1,000 or more;

(2) a permit for expansion of a swine facility to an animal unit capacity of 1,000 or more; or

(3) renewal of a permit for a swine facility that has an animal unit capacity of 1,000 or more.

(b) Each swine facility that is required to submit an odor control plan shall amend such plan whenever warranted by changes in the facility or in other conditions affecting the facility.

(c) In promulgating rules and regulations governing odor control plans, the secretary shall take into consideration different sizes of facilities and other relevant factors.

History: L. 1998, ch. 143, ยง 11; May 7.
